If you are fired from a position in a retail business for petty theft, grand theft, larceny do you forfeit your rights to unemployment benefits?

Question Details: If you are fired for theft do you still retain your unemployment benefits?

I doubt it.  I'm not a California attorney, and the law of unemployment benefits can differ from one state to another, but this is a firing for good cause.  In every state I've checked, that makes you ineligible for unemployment.
